What is Bostik SAF 30 LOT Methacrylate Adhesives and why choose it?
Bostik SAF 30 LOT Methacrylate Adhesives is a white, thixotropic and viscous liquid resin used as part of a multi-component adhesive and sealant kit. Based on methyl methacrylate chemistry and containing nanoforms, it is designed for demanding bonding applications where controlled viscosity and strong adhesion are required. The formulation is classified as a highly flammable liquid with skin, eye and respiratory irritation potential, making it suitable for professional and industrial users who work under controlled safety conditions.
This product is particularly suitable where a methacrylate resin component is needed within a kit system, offering reliable performance when handled, stored and transported according to the detailed safety and transport information provided in its Safety Data Sheet.

Technical specifications
- Product type: Resin component of methacrylate adhesive kit.
- Physical state: Liquid.
- Appearance: Thixotropic, viscous.
- Colour: White.
- Odour: Slight.
- Density: 1.13 g/cm³.
- Dynamic viscosity: 500,000 – 800,000 mPa·s at 23 °C.
- Initial boiling point: ≥ 101 °C.
- Flash point: 10 °C.
- Vapour pressure: < 110 kPa.
- Recommended storage temperature: Keep between 5 °C and 25 °C.
- Maximum storage temperature: Do not store above 30 °C / 86 °F.
- Explosive properties: In use, may form flammable/explosive vapour–air mixtures; powdered material may form explosive dust–air mixtures.
- Chemical stability: Stable under normal conditions; hazardous polymerisation may occur upon depletion of inhibitor.
- Conditions to avoid: Heat, flames, sparks and other ignition sources.
- Incompatible materials: Rust, strong acids, strong bases, strong oxidising agents.

Section 8 – Personal protective measures
When handling Bostik SAF 30 LOT Methacrylate Adhesives, implement the exposure controls and personal protection specified in Section 8 of the Safety Data Sheet:
Engineering controls
- Ensure adequate ventilation, especially in confined areas.
- Exhaust vapours and aerosols directly at the point of origin.
Eye and face protection
- Wear safety glasses with side shields or chemical goggles.
- Eye protection must conform to EN 166.
Hand protection
- Recommended glove materials:
- Nitrile rubber, glove thickness > 0.4 mm.
- Latex gloves.
- Polyethylene or polypropylene gloves, thickness ≥ 0.15 mm.
- Ensure that the breakthrough time of the glove material is not exceeded; consult the glove supplier for specific data.
- Gloves must conform to EN 374.
Skin and body protection
- Wear suitable protective clothing to avoid skin contact.
Respiratory protection
- None required under normal conditions of use with adequate ventilation.
- If needed, use an organic gases and vapours filter conforming to EN 14387.
Hygiene measures
- Do not eat, drink or smoke when using this product.
- Wash hands before breaks and after handling.
- Contaminated work clothing should not leave the workplace and should be washed before reuse.
Environmental exposure controls
- Do not allow uncontrolled discharge into the environment.
Section 14 – Transport information
Bostik SAF 30 LOT Methacrylate Adhesives is classified as a dangerous good for transport. The following information is taken from Section 14 of the Safety Data Sheet and applies primarily to bulk shipments:
ADR/RID (Road and Rail transport)
- UN number: UN1133.
- UN proper shipping name: Adhesives.
- Transport hazard class: 3 (flammable liquids).
- Packing group: II.
- Description: UN1133, Adhesives, 3, II, (D/E).
- Environmental hazards: Not classified as environmentally hazardous for ADR.
- Special provisions: 640D.
- Classification code: F1.
- Tunnel restriction code: (D/E).
- Limited quantity (LQ): 5 L.
- ADR Hazard ID (Kemmler number): 33.
IMDG (Maritime transport)
- UN number: UN1133.
- UN proper shipping name: Adhesives.
- Transport hazard class: 3.
- Packing group: II.
- Description: UN1133, Adhesives, 3, II, (10 °C c.c.).
- Marine pollutant: NP (not a marine pollutant).
- Special provisions: None.
- Limited quantity (LQ): 5 L.
- EmS: F-E, S-D.
- Transport in bulk according to MARPOL / IBC Code: Not applicable.
IATA/ICAO (Air transport)
- UN number: UN1133.
- UN proper shipping name: Adhesives.
- Transport hazard class: 3.
- Packing group: II.
- Description: UN1133, Adhesives, 3, II.
- Environmental hazards: Not classified as environmentally hazardous for air transport.
- Special provisions: A3.
- Limited quantity (LQ): 1 L.
- ERG code: 3L.
FAQ about Bostik SAF 30 LOT Methacrylate Adhesives
-
Is Bostik SAF 30 LOT Methacrylate Adhesives flammable?
Yes. It is classified as a Flammable liquid Category 2 (H225), described as a highly flammable liquid and vapour. It can form flammable or explosive vapour–air mixtures during use.
-
What is the recommended storage temperature?
Store between 5 °C and 25 °C, and do not exceed 30 °C / 86 °F. Keep containers tightly closed in a cool, dry and well-ventilated area away from heat, sparks and open flames.
-
What personal protective equipment should be used when handling this product?
Use safety glasses with side shields or goggles (EN 166), chemical-resistant gloves (for example nitrile rubber > 0.4 mm or polyethylene/polypropylene ≥ 0.15 mm, EN 374 compliant) and suitable protective clothing. In case of insufficient ventilation, use an organic vapour respirator with a filter conforming to EN 14387.
-
Can Bostik SAF 30 LOT Methacrylate Adhesives cause allergic reactions?
Yes. The product is classified as Skin sensitisation Category 1 (H317) and may cause an allergic skin reaction in susceptible individuals.
-
What should I do in case of skin contact?
Wash immediately with soap and plenty of water while removing contaminated clothing and shoes. If skin irritation or allergic reactions occur, seek medical attention.
-
What is the appearance and odour of the product?
It is a white, thixotropic, viscous liquid with a slight odour.
-
Is the product hazardous to the environment?
Based on available data, the mixture as a whole is not classified as hazardous to the aquatic environment, but it contains components that are harmful to aquatic life. Uncontrolled release into the environment should be avoided.
-
How should waste and empty packaging be disposed of?
Do not release the product into the environment. Dispose of residues and contaminated packaging in accordance with local regulations. Empty containers can present a fire and explosion hazard and must not be cut, punctured or welded.
-
Does the product contain substances of very high concern (SVHC) above 0.1 %?
No. According to the Safety Data Sheet, it does not contain candidate substances of very high concern at concentrations ≥ 0.1 %.
-
Is Bostik SAF 30 LOT Methacrylate Adhesives suitable for general public use?
If supplied to the general public, the product requires tactile warnings. It is formulated primarily for professional and industrial use where proper safety measures can be implemented.
